I got my Kizashi 3 weeks ago and immediately debadged it and tinted the windows and painted the front S. Last week I clay bared my car followed by polish, glaze and sealant. I replaced the "city lights" with led's and changed the high and low beam bulbs to Philips CrystalVision 5000K.
